
To customize the sensitivity of your TECKNET GM299 Optical Mouse, you can easily adjust the DPI (dots per inch) settings. Here's how:
DPI Switching: Your GM299 mouse allows you to cycle through various DPI levels, ranging from 1000 to 7000. Use the dedicated DPI+ and DPI- buttons, usually located on the top of the mouse, to switch between these settings.
DPI Adjustment: Press the DPI+ button to increase the DPI, making the mouse cursor move faster. Press the DPI- button to decrease the DPI, making the cursor move slower. The LED light on the mouse will change color to indicate the current DPI level:
Customization for Optimal Performance: Experiment with different DPI levels to find the perfect sensitivity for your needs. Higher DPI settings are often preferred for fast-paced gaming, while lower DPI settings can be beneficial for precision tasks such as design work or general computer use.
